The station is equipped with essential ticket facilities, including a ticket office open weekdays from 06:10 to 12:50 and Saturdays from 08:40 to 15:20. There's also a ticket machine for those who prefer a self-service option. Collecting pre-booked tickets is straightforward, ensuring convenience for all travelers.
Accessibility support is available although the station is categorized as 'C' meaning it doesn't offer step-free access. Nonetheless, assistance with navigation and ramps for train access are in place, supported by helpful staff during opening hours. For those planning to carry their bicycles, Swanscombe station provides six sheltered spaces, allowing passengers to park their cycles with ease, although cycle hire is not available here.
Swanscombe also enjoys connectivity beyond rail, boasting additional transport options like the local bus service. The rail replacement service ensures uninterrupted journeys towards Greenhithe and Northfleet with accessible stops. For those looking to continue their travel via bus, printable schedules are conveniently available here, facilitating smooth transitions between modes of transport.

Kensal Rise station offers essential amenities, ensuring a seamless travel experience. If you're looking to purchase tickets, the station is equipped with ticket machines capable of handling both traditional and accessible needs. You can also collect your tickets bought online at these machines. The station, however, does not have a ticket office or smartcard services, and while step-free access is available, it requires a scenic 200m street journey for platform interchange.
For those seeking assistance, help points are scattered around the station. Information is abundantly available through departure and arrival screens, as well as audio announcements, making navigation straightforward. Unfortunately, there are no luggage storage or lost property services, but rest assured, the presence of CCTV ensures a level of safety.
While Kensal Rise caters to individuals with mobility needs through ramps and step-free access, it's not completely equipped for all accessibility requirements. Notably, the station lacks accessible toilets and other supportive amenities like wheelchairs. Travelers can find a comfortable spot to rest in the waiting rooms, which are open during mornings into early afternoon from Monday to Saturday.
For cyclists, there are four spaces with sheltered cycle hoops monitored by CCTV. Although no bicycle hire facilities exist, the parking arrangement is convenient for those commuting by bike.
The station acts as a vibrant node for onward journeys. Bus stops at Station Terrace and Chamberlayne Road offer connections east to Camden Road and west to Richmond, respectively. For those flying out or in, connecting at West Hampstead allows access to trains bound for London Luton and Gatwick Airports. More detailed journey planning and bus links can be found here.
